Overriding Instance Method in Rails Library


This seems like a monkey patch. How can I improve it?

Trying to override the deliver_now instance method from the ActionMailer::MessageDelivery class. The below code works.

However, is there a way I can achieve this more elegantly say through class inheritance or some other way? The end code is used in a custom ActionMailer mailer.

module MyModule
  class Ses 

    ActionMailer::MessageDelivery.class_eval do
      def deliver_now!
        puts self.to
        puts self.subject
      end
    end
    ...
  end
end

Solution

  • You might look into Ruby's refinements

    An example refinement:

    module MyMessageRefinement
      refine(ActionMailer::MessageDelivery) do
        def deliver_now!
          puts self.to
          puts self.subject
        end
      end    
    end
    

    Then in your class:

    module MyModule
      class Ses 
        using MyMessageRefinement
      end
    end
